EGA reports revenues of AED 15.08 billion for H1 2025

Emirates Global Aluminium (EGA), a premium aluminum producer based in the UAE, reported its revenues of AED 15.08 billion for the first half of 2025. The company's underlying earnings before interest, taxes, depreciation, and amortization (EBITDA) reached AED 3.82 billion, while underlying net profit before adjustments was AED 1.63 billion.

During the period, EGA sold 1.37 million tons of cast metal to more than 400 customers globally, an increase from 1.31 million tons in the first half of 2024. The share of premium aluminum increased to 84% of sales, up from 82% in the first half of 2024. Higher sales of billet, slab, and purity products offset weaker-than-expected foundry demand caused by the automotive industry's performance.
